Alternativa Sociale (English language: Social Alternative) is an Italian political coalition of neo-fascist parties. The coalition grew from Libertà di Azione, which was established by Benito Mussolini's granddaughter Alessandra Mussolini after she left the Alleanza Nazionale due to their attempts to move away from their Fascist past. Mussolini united her group with the Fronte Sociale Nazionale, Fiamma Tricolore and Forza Nuova for the European Parliament election, 2004, gaining one seat in the European Parliament. The group is committed to a strong Italian nationalism that celebrates and glorifies its past, and has been particularly critical of Gianfranco Fini's modernisation of the right.
